Online Casino vs. Land-Based: Which Offers the Better Experience?

In today’s fast-paced world, the debate between online casino and land-based experiences is more relevant than ever. While flashy lights and buzzing slots draw many to traditional venues, digital casinos offer unmatched convenience and innovation. But which one truly delivers the better gambling experience?

Convenience at Your Fingertips

One of the most significant advantages of an online casino is accessibility. Players can spin the reels or play blackjack from the comfort of their home, during their lunch break, or even while commuting. Traveling, dressing up, or waiting in queues is unnecessary.

Digital platforms are open 24/7, allowing players to play whenever they choose. This level of flexibility has become especially appealing in today’s digital-first era, where smartphones and tablets are always within reach.

In contrast, land-based casinos require travel time, fixed opening hours, and sometimes entry restrictions based on dress code or location. Online gaming fits better into daily life for players with busy schedules.

Atmosphere and Social Interaction

Despite the growth of virtual casinos, many still crave the physical atmosphere of an actual casino floor. The buzz of people, the sound of chips, and the glitz of a roulette wheel can’t be fully replicated online.

Land-based venues often offer a more immersive and emotional experience. There’s also the added element of live social interaction  chatting with other players or dealers, enjoying a drink, or soaking in the high-stakes tension at a poker table.

However, virtual platforms are catching up. Many modern online casino sites offer live dealer games, where professional hosts interact with players in real-time via high-quality video. While it might not replace the complete thrill of being there, it does close the gap significantly for those who want realism and remote access.

Game Variety and Innovation

Traditional casinos are often limited by space. There’s only so much room for tables and slot machines. But in the digital realm, this limitation doesn’t exist. An online casino can host hundreds — even thousands — of games, from classic favourites to cutting-edge variations.

Players can explore themed slots, real money games, live tables, and new formats like crash games or skill-based tournaments. Developers can experiment more freely online, using digital gaming trends to create fresh experiences that are impossible in a physical venue.

Moreover, software updates and game launches happen quickly in the iGaming industry. That means online players get access to the latest innovations before anyone else.

Bonuses and Player Rewards

Virtual casinos often offer far more generous bonuses than their land-based counterparts if you’re looking for value. Online platforms regularly reward new users with welcome offers, free spins, and deposit matches. Loyalty programmes, cashback, and seasonal promotions are also standard.

These incentives help players extend their playtime and try more games without risking as much of their own money. In contrast, rewards at physical casinos are usually tied to how much you spend in-house — think complimentary drinks or hotel discounts.

Competition in the online space means that platforms are constantly trying to attract and retain players with attractive perks.

Security, Fairness, and Trust

Safety and fairness are top concerns when gambling online. Reputable online casino operators are licensed and regulated by governing bodies such as the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ority. They use secure encryption, random number generators, and clear terms and conditions.

Similarly, land-based venues must also meet strict regulatory standards. However, seeing a physical table or dealer gives some people a stronger sense of trust and transparency.

To bridge this gap, online casinos now provide live-streamed games and third-party certifications to prove fairness. Still, the decision often concerns personal comfort with digital transactions and tech-based gameplay.

Cost and Comfort Considerations

Playing at home means no travel costs, dress codes, or expensive food or drinks. The cost of visiting a land-based casino adds up — from transport and parking to optional entertainment and dining.

With an online casino, players can set their budget, play at their own pace, and take breaks whenever they like. There’s no pressure from others at the table, and beginners can learn the ropes privately using demo modes.

For those who value comfort and control, the digital route wins hands down.

The Verdict: Which Experience Reigns Supreme?

The truth is, there’s no one-size-fits-all answer. It depends on what the player values most. If it’s ambience, human interaction, and a night out, land-based casinos provide that unique charm. If it’s accessibility, choice, and innovation, then the online casino world has the upper hand.

Many modern players now occasionally visit physical venues while sticking to digital gaming for daily play. The key is understanding what suits your preferences, lifestyle, and gambling goals.
